At a rate of about $70 per night for a room with 2 queen beds, this was less expensive than equivalent motels in the area that seem to go from $90 up. It is not luxurious, but was very clean and has most amenities that people expect in a room including a small refrigerator and microwave. It served a continental... More

Anyone should feel comfortable in this motel due to the amenities provided, including expansive choices for breakfast (self-service waffles with regular or lite syrup, hot and dry cereals, peeled boiled eggs, margarine or butter, soy milk, 3 bread choices, pastries, coffee or tea--you get the idea). Room had a specially sanitized remote control, grab bars in shower/bath, wall thermostat, fridge,... More
